#ifndef __XFS_QUOTA_H__
#define __XFS_QUOTA_H__
#ident "$Revision: 1.14 $"
/*
 * External Interface to the XFS disk quota subsystem.
 */
struct	bhv_desc;
struct  vfs;
struct  xfs_disk_dquot;
struct  xfs_dqhash;
struct  xfs_dquot;
struct  xfs_inode;
struct  xfs_mount;
struct  xfs_trans;

/* 
 * We use only 16-bit prid's in the inode, not the 64-bit version in the proc.
 * uid_t is hard-coded to 32 bits in the inode. Hence, an 'id' in a dquot is
 * 32 bits..
 */
typedef __int32_t	xfs_dqid_t;
/*
 * Eventhough users may not have quota limits occupying all 64-bits, 
 * they may need 64-bit accounting. Hence, 64-bit quota-counters,
 * and quota-limits. This is a waste in the common case, but heh ...
 */
typedef __uint64_t	xfs_qcnt_t;
typedef __uint16_t      xfs_qwarncnt_t;

/* 
 * Disk quotas status in m_qflags, and also sb_qflags. 16 bits.
 */
#define XFS_UQUOTA_ACCT	0x0001  /* user quota accounting ON */
#define XFS_UQUOTA_ENFD	0x0002  /* user quota limits enforced */
#define XFS_UQUOTA_CHKD	0x0004  /* quotacheck run on usr quotas */
#define XFS_PQUOTA_ACCT	0x0008  /* project quota accounting ON */
#define XFS_PQUOTA_ENFD	0x0010  /* proj quota limits enforced */
#define XFS_PQUOTA_CHKD	0x0020  /* quotacheck run on prj quotas */

/* 
 * Incore only flags for quotaoff - these bits get cleared when quota(s)
 * are in the process of getting turned off. These flags are in m_qflags but
 * never in sb_qflags.
 */
#define XFS_UQUOTA_ACTIVE	0x0040  /* uquotas are being turned off */
#define XFS_PQUOTA_ACTIVE	0x0080  /* pquotas are being turned off */

/*
 * Typically, we turn quotas off if we weren't explicitly asked to 
 * mount quotas. This is the mount option not to do that.
 * This option is handy in the miniroot, when trying to mount /root.
 * We can't really know what's in /etc/fstab until /root is already mounted!
 * This stops quotas getting turned off in the root filesystem everytime
 * the system boots up a miniroot.
 */
#define XFS_QUOTA_MAYBE		0x0100 /* Turn quotas on if SB has quotas on */

/*
 * Checking XFS_IS_*QUOTA_ON() while holding any inode lock guarantees
 * quota will be not be switched off as long as that inode lock is held.
 */
#define XFS_IS_QUOTA_ON(mp)  	((mp)->m_qflags & (XFS_UQUOTA_ACTIVE | \
						   XFS_PQUOTA_ACTIVE))
#define XFS_IS_UQUOTA_ON(mp)	((mp)->m_qflags & XFS_UQUOTA_ACTIVE)
#define XFS_IS_PQUOTA_ON(mp) 	((mp)->m_qflags & XFS_PQUOTA_ACTIVE)

/*
 * This check is done typically without holding the inode lock;
 * that may seem racey, but it is harmless in the context that it is used.
 * The inode cannot go inactive as long a reference is kept, and 
 * therefore if dquot(s) were attached, they'll stay consistent.
 * If, for example, the ownership of the inode changes while
 * we didnt have the inode locked, the appropriate dquot(s) will be
 * attached atomically.
 */
#define XFS_NOT_DQATTACHED(mp, ip) ((XFS_IS_UQUOTA_ON(mp) &&\
				     (ip)->i_udquot == NULL) || \
				    (XFS_IS_PQUOTA_ON(mp) && \
				     (ip)->i_pdquot == NULL))
